1064-2050nm PM Faraday Rotator

The 1064-2050nm PM Faraday Rotator from Kernstech is an advanced optical component designed to manipulate the polarization of light in fiber-optic systems. With its wide operating wavelength range from 1064 nm to 2050 nm, this polarization-maintaining (PM) Faraday rotator is ideal for use in high-performance systems requiring precise polarization control. The rotator features low insertion loss, high return loss, and excellent stability, ensuring reliable performance in telecommunications, fiber lasers, and fiber-optic instrumentation. With its robust design, this Faraday rotator offers both durability and precision, making it a critical component in various optical and research applications.

Product Description

ParameterSpecUnit
Center Wavelength2050,2000,19501550,1480,13101064nm
Operating Wavelength Range±15±20±5nm
Max.Insertion Loss1.30.51.6dB
Min.Extinction Ratio @23℃182020dB
Faraday Rotation Angle for CWL45deg
Max.Rotation Angle Tolerance at 23℃for CWL±2deg
Max.Polarization ModeDispersion0.05ps
Max.Power Handling300mW
Max.Tensile Load5N
Axis AlignmentBoth Axis Working/
Fiber TypePM Panda Fiber/
Operating temperature-5~+70
Storage temperature-40~+85

Product Features

 Wide Wavelength Range: The 1064-2050nm PM Faraday Rotator operates across a broad range of wavelengths, including key values like 1064 nm, 1310 nm, 1550 nm, and 2050 nm, making it highly versatile for use in different optical systems.

 High Performance: The device offers low insertion loss (up to 0.5 dB at 1550 nm) and high return loss, ensuring minimal signal degradation and reliable performance over time.

 Polarization Maintenance: With its PM Panda fiber design, the rotator ensures that polarization-dependent effects are maintained, which is crucial for high-precision applications.

 Wide Temperature Range: It operates effectively across a broad temperature range from -5°C to +70°C, making it suitable for use in various environments.

 High Stability and Durability: The Faraday rotator is built to offer high reliability and stability, even under challenging conditions, with a maximum tensile load of 5 N.

FAQ

Q1: What wavelengths does this Faraday rotator support?

A1: The 1064-2050nm PM Faraday Rotator supports a wide range of wavelengths, including 1064 nm, 1310 nm, 1550 nm, 1480 nm, and 2050 nm, making it versatile for many optical systems.

Q2: How much insertion loss does the rotator have?

A2: The insertion loss varies depending on the wavelength but ranges from 0.5 dB (at 1550 nm) to 1.6 dB (at 1064 nm), ensuring minimal signal loss during operation.

Q3: What is the maximum power the Faraday rotator can handle?

A3: The maximum power handling for the PM Faraday Rotator is 300 mW, which makes it suitable for high-power applications without compromising performance.

Q4: What fiber type is compatible with this Faraday rotator?

A4: This Faraday rotator is designed for use with PM Panda fiber, which maintains the polarization of the light during rotation.
